How you can do something like that? Well, the speedpicking and sweeping stuff is nothing but praticing for hours, again and again. Start a metronome at around 66 bpm, and play little licks, then increase the speed to 72 bpm and so on. If you can play some nice 16th in 140-160 bpm you´re above average.
Best way to speed up your hands, is nothing but a G-Major pentatonic pattern3 played all the way from 60 to 200 bpm, and always use alternate picking!
